Abstract

The purpose of this research is to examine the supermarket retail employees’ perception on the impact of the individual and organisational factors contributing to workplace theft behaviour in supermarkets in Malaysia and also to study the mediating effect of intention to steal and the moderating effect of internal control systems. Data was collected from 450 retail employees of eight supermarkets in six states in Malaysia through a self-administered questionnaire following stratified random sampling.
